MISOL Solar Hot Water Heater with 10 Tubes
After testing the MISOL Solar Collector for two months, here’s how it performs for my home hot water heating needs. This solar collector features 10 evacuated glass tubes, each with a diameter of 58mm and a length of 500mm, making it compact yet efficient. The outer shell is made of durable aluminum alloy, and it has a rock wool insulating layer that enhances its thermal efficiency. MISOL 110V Solar Water Heater Controller
After testing the MISOL 110V controller for my solar water heater over the past month, here’s how it performs for managing a separated pressurized solar hot water system. This controller, measuring 187mm x 128mm x 46mm, is designed to work with one collector array, one storage tank, and one pump, making it ideal for homeowners looking to optimize their solar heating setup.

Faq about best solar water heaters:
1:What is a solar water heater?
A solar water heater uses sunlight to heat water for residential or commercial use, providing an energy-efficient alternative to traditional heating methods.
2:How do solar water heaters work?
Solar water heaters capture sunlight using solar panels, converting it into heat, which is then transferred to water stored in a tank.
3:What are the benefits of using solar water heaters?
Benefits include reduced energy bills, lower carbon footprint, and minimal maintenance costs, making them an eco-friendly choice.
4:Are solar water heaters effective in all climates?
Yes, solar water heaters can be effective in various climates, although performance may vary based on sunlight availability and system design.
5:What types of solar water heaters are available?
Common types include active systems, passive systems, and thermosiphon systems, each with unique features and efficiencies.
6:How much can I save with a solar water heater?
Savings depend on local energy costs and system efficiency, but users typically save 50-80% on water heating bills.
7:What is the lifespan of a solar water heater?
Most solar water heaters have a lifespan of 15-20 years with proper maintenance, ensuring long-term savings and efficiency.
